Oleh: denysutani | Juni 4, 2009

DB2 Data Movement utilities (EXPORT)

Ada 3 utiliti data movement di DB2
– EXPORT
– IMPORT
– LOAD

Untuk artikel ini kita khusus membahas mengenai export.

Beberapa file format yang didukung
– Non-delimited or fixed-length ASCII (ASC)
– Delimited ASCII (DEL)
– PC version of the Integrated Exchange Format (PC/IXF)
– Worksheet Format (WSF)
– Cursor

Untuk melakukan operasi export maka dibutuhkan hak akses minimal select terhadap tabel atau view yang hendak di export. Dalam melakukan export, kita perlu memberikan perhatian khusus terhadap LBAC (label based access control). LBAC ini dapat membatasi akses kita terhadap sebuah row atau column dari sebuah table. Jika LBAC melakukan blok terhadap row, maka operasi export dapat berjalan dengan lancar, namun row yang diblok tersebut tidak akan ikut, namun jika blok terhadap column maka operasi export akan gagal.

Berikut syntax dasar EXPORT

EXPORT TO file_name OF file_type
MODIFIED BY file_type_modifiers
MESSAGES message_file
select_statement

Contoh sederhana untuk export nama dari table staff dan disimpan ke myfile.del
db2 export to myfile.del of del message msg.out select name from staff

Jika merasa kesulitan dengan menggunakan command prompt, DB2 telah menyediakan DB2 Control Center. Anda tinggal mencari table yang ingin diexport,klik kanan kemudian pilih export. Disana berbagai macam option telah tersedia seperti export LOB dan XML dll.

Semoga bermanfaat.


Tinggalkan Balasan

Isikan data di bawah atau klik salah satu ikon untuk log in:

Logo WordPress.com

You are commenting using your WordPress.com account. Logout / Ubah )

Gambar Twitter

You are commenting using your Twitter account. Logout / Ubah )

Foto Facebook

You are commenting using your Facebook account. Logout / Ubah )

Foto Google+

You are commenting using your Google+ account. Logout / Ubah )

Connecting to %s

Kategori

%d blogger menyukai ini: